Product Description:

SecretBook is an encrypted personal information database for Mac OS X. It allows you to easily and safely store all those little bits of information like passwords and software licenses. It supports many OS X features such as Spotlight searches.

What's new in this version:

  • iPhone viewer
  • Full support for Leopard and Tiger
  • User interface improvements
  • French Localisation
